Most 12 Volt blowers on put out 150 CFM or less and that's far less than your engine needs to run in the stock configuration.

These electric blowers work great for moving air but are NOT designed for the volume and pressure required to supercharge an engine.

Real superchargers flow 600 CFM or higher and are designed to do it at 5-15 lbs boost pressure.

Also sticking some crazy big jets with an electric blower motor would make your jet-ski perform worse than stock.
